While technology moves towards USB Type-C and high-speed multi-gigabit interfaces, the Micro USB standard remains a critical, highly-stable interface for trillions of active industrial legacy systems, diagnostic equipment, and cost-sensitive consumer modules. High reliability in these interfaces requires specialized contact engineering. Our connectors utilize copper alloy pins with customized gold-plating layer thicknesses (up to 30u") to combat mechanical degradation under continuous mating-unmating cycles (rated for over 10,000 cycles).

Our advanced tool-making department designs, repairs, and operates high-speed progressive metal stamping dies. This enables us to maintain structural and dimension tolerances within micrometers, preventing assembly shifts in customer devices.
Using CCD optical measurement networks and automated vector network analyzers (VNA), we evaluate electrical continuity, insulation resistance, and transceiver eye-pattern diagnostics directly on the production floor.
We ensure all manufacturing stages comply with RoHS, REACH, and WEEE directives, facilitating smooth customs clearance and import compliance for EU and North American markets.

Industrial edge controllers utilize our rugged Micro USB and SMT RJ45 connectors for field programming and local network routing. Robust housing shell designs protect data lines from industrial-grade EMI emissions, high moisture, and thermal stress.
Fiber-to-the-home (FTTH) architectures and local distribution frames require high-density modular jacks and SFP cage frameworks. Our TE-compatible press-fit cages ensure optimal signal density with low structural loss.
Inside smart car control centers, physical vibration threatens electrical stability. Our high-retention-force Micro USB and SMT connectors prevent connection failures during transit, maintaining communication with central processors.

We perform Bit Error Rate (BER) testing, optical power measurement, and wavelength analysis on all active modules, ensuring stable transmissions over distances up to 40km without data loss.
Connector components undergo mechanical stress testing, contact resistance profiling, and temperature cycling in environmental chambers to confirm performance under thermal stress.
Raw copper alloys, LCP polymer pellets, optical laser diodes, and printed circuit boards are inspected for purity, composition, and dimension accuracy before entering the production line.
Transceiver modules are tested for firmware compatibility across major switch vendor platforms, ensuring seamless integration into heterogeneous network environments.
